check before alignment

Hi Erin, welcome to our little club. I don't know where to get aligned,but be sure and check strut tower mount. Look in top of tower mount to make sure rubber bushing that holds end of strut is not tore. I had my S serviced at D&R and found mine to be tore even though car only has 34000 mi. Pothole can also mushroom tower so look over closely. If you have a problem there are upgrades. I am ordering mine Monday.
Good luck,Larry
